MAX11068EVKIT+ Maxim Integrated Products, MAX11068EVKIT+ Datasheet - Page 66

no-image

MAX11068EVKIT+

Manufacturer Part Number
MAX11068EVKIT+
Description
KIT SMART BATT MEASUREMENT 12CH
Manufacturer
Maxim Integrated Products
Datasheets

Specifications of MAX11068EVKIT+

Main Purpose
Power Management, Battery Monitor, Car
Utilized Ic / Part
MAX11068
Primary Attributes
Monitors Current, Voltage, Temperature
Secondary Attributes
1 ~ 12 Cell- Li-Ion, 1 ~ 12 Cell- NiMH
Lead Free Status / RoHS Status
Lead free / RoHS Compliant
Embedded
-
12-Channel, High-Voltage Sensor, Smart
Data-Acquisition Interface
Figure 41. I
Figure 41 shows the I
diagrams.
The HELLOALL command automatically assigns each
device a unique address. This address can be used
during a WRITEDEVICE command to write to only one
selected device in the SMBus ladder, and is also read
during the ROLLCALL command to identify all the unique
active devices present on the bus. When all the device
addresses are known, the last device in the chain can
be identified and made known to all ports. It is important
for each node and the host to know the relationship of
devices that make up the SMBus ladder so that the PEC
byte used in some command protocols can be properly
located and calculated.
The device address of the first device in the SMBus lad-
der stack is specified with the HELLOALL command.
This address is incremented by 1 before being sent to
each successive downstream device. The maximum
device address is 0x1Fh and the address counter wraps
to 0 if the starting address was set too high for the num-
ber of devices in the chain. The SMBus-laddered devic-
es only forward WRITEDEVICE commands that have a
66
SDA
SCL
SCL
SDA
U
U
L
L
P
2
C Lower and Upper Port Timing Diagrams
I
t
BUF
I
2
2
C Functional Description
C Port Timing Diagrams
S
t
HD-STA
2
C lower and upper port timing
t
t
LOW
LS-DAT
Autoaddressing
DATA
t
LS-CLK
t
HD-DAT
t
DATA
MCL-MIN
t
HD-DAT
higher device address than their own. So, some devices
are not addressable if the addresses A[0:4] written by
HELLOALL are allowed to wrap past 0x1Fh.
When a pack is removed or inserted, the SMBus lad-
der must be reconfigured. The HELLOALL, ROLLCALL,
and SETLASTADDRESS sequence should be used to
reinitialize the device addresses and the address of the
last device.
If the SCL
28ms, then any transaction is aborted and the device
behaves as if it observed a STOP condition. The host
can ensure that all devices are in a “ready-to-communi-
cate” state by remaining idle for longer than 28ms.
For optimal data transfer, the host microcontroller should
make extensive use of the WRITEALL and READALL
commands. One READALL or ROLLCALL command
consumes the following amount of time based on the
number of bits in the command protocol and the number
of devices in the SMBus ladder:
t
SU-DAT
t
READALL
U
DATA
input remains high or low for longer than
t
HIGH
=
+
(
5 8 bits 5 bits 3 bits
N
×
MODULES
Pack Insertion and Removal
DATA
Communication Timeout
+
×
(
16 bits 2 bits
+
Interface Speed
+
DATA
)
×
t
SCL
)
×
DATA
t
SCL

Related parts for MAX11068EVKIT+